7.2.9 OUTPUT RELAYS

To verify the functionality of the output relays, perform the following steps:

1.

Using the setpoint:

S12 TESTING

ÖØ

TEST OUTPUT RELAYS

ÖØ

FORCE OPERATION OF RELAYS:

"R1 Trip"

select and store values as per the table below, verifying operation

The R6 Service relay is failsafe or energized normally. Operating R6 causes it to de-energize.
